10-jmeter setup用户登录获取token全局化
简介:
Setup线程是用于获取权限或token使用的,才有访问接口的权限。在测试的时候,我们的关注点其实是当前测试的接口,登录只是一个前置操作,
像 python 的 unittest 和 pytest 框架都有 setUp 的概念,前置操作用来准备测试数据,jmeter 里面也有个 setUp 线程组可以实现前置准备工作。
Setup线程:
我们需要获取登录操作的token共其他的接口使用,那么就可以通过setup前置操作,获取登录token
将获取的登录token全局化
添加后置处理器-BeanShell后置处理程序-> ${__setProperty(token_global,${token},)}
这样其他线程组的请求头就可以调用到了
线程组获取的token